# Alameda (US NGZ)

**UN/LOCODE:** US NGZ  
**Country:** United States  
**Water Body:** North Pacific Ocean  
**Harbor Size:** Small  
**Harbor Type:** Coastal (Natural)  
**GPS:** 37.7833, -122.2667

The first container crane on the US West Coast was installed at Alameda's Encinal Terminals in 1959, yet this island in San Francisco Bay carries little commercial freight relevance today. Liner and box traffic long ago moved to neighbouring Oakland, the former Encinal Terminals are being redeveloped into a residential and mixed-use district, and the LOCODE US NGZ still nods to the old Naval Air Station Alameda. What remains is a solid ship-repair and dry-dock cluster used by yards such as Bay Ship & Yacht. Shippers moving containers, breakbulk or customs-cleared imports should route through the Port of Oakland, only a few kilometres away.
